Brisbane Broncos player Josiah Carapani has been dropped from the squad for the Round 18 game against Cronulla for disciplinary reasons after the 24-year-old was stopped by police on Sunday morning.
The club confirmed on Monday that Carapani was stopped by Queensland Police on the Pacific Motorway after he was spotted driving nearly 20km over the speed limit. He was administered a breathalyzer and recorded a blood alcohol level of 0.037, above the limit for a provisional license holder.

“After being stopped at the side of the road, Josiah was taken to Holland Park Police Station where a breath test was carried out which returned a reading of 0.037,” the club said in a statement.
“As a temporary license holder (P. Plater), Josiah must have a blood alcohol concentration of zero.”
He also received a speeding citation for speeding, as well as additional citations for “failure to display P plates,” “driving an unregistered vehicle,” and “driving an uninsured vehicle.”
The club confirmed that the NRL’s integrity department had been informed and that Carapani had been given a court date at the end of July.
